The LRD05 is a thermal overload relay from Schneider Electric's TeSys series, delivering essential protection for electrical motors. It features a thermal overload class of 10A in accordance with IEC 60947-4-1 standards, ensuring precise performance in various applications.

The TeSys LRD05 by Schneider Electric is a robust thermal overload relay that effectively guards against motor overheating and potential damage. It is engineered to operate within a network frequency range of 0 to 400 Hz. This relay features a thermal overload class designation of Class 10A conforming to the IEC 60947-4-1 standard.
With a tripping threshold calibrated at 1.14 ± 0.06 Ir, the device accurately responds to conditions that might lead to overheating, thereby safeguarding motor assets. The design incorporates an auxiliary contact arrangement, consisting of one normally open (NO) and one normally closed (NC) contact, enhancing its utility in various applications.
Temperature fluctuations can be accommodated with a working range extending from -4°F to 140°F (-20°C to 60°C), making it suitable for diverse operational environments. The physical dimensions of the LRD05 are compact, with a height of 2.6 inches (66 mm), a width of 1.8 inches, and a depth of 2.8 inches, which makes it easy to install in confined spaces. Additionally, it weighs approximately 0.273 pounds.
In terms of dielectric performance, the relay exhibits a dielectric strength of 1.89 kV at 50 Hz according to IEC 60947-1 standards. It also withstands impulse voltages up to 6 kV. The LRD05 is rated for a maximum operational voltage of 690 V and has a rated insulation voltage ([Ui]) of 600 V per CSA standards, ensuring compliance with relevant electrical safety regulations. Furthermore, its climatic endurance is classified according to IACS E10, demonstrating resilience under various environmental conditions.
